среда, 9 апреля 2014 г.

"Табличные величины", урок №4

Алгоритмы сортировки линейного массива (часть 1)

Из этого урока вы узнаете:
  • на какие группы делятся алгоритмы сортировки массивов
  • что такое "Метод Пузырька" 

ЛИСТИНГ ПРОГРАММЫ
Метод обменной сортировки - Метод Пузырька
Program puzyrok;
uses crt;
Var i,j,c: integer;
    A: array[1..10] of integer;
Begin
clrscr;
{заполняем таблицу и печатаем её}
for i:=1 to 10 do
begin
A[i]:=random(10)-5;
writeln('A[',i:2,']=',A[i]:3);
end;
for i:=1 to 9 do
for j:=i+1 to 10 do
if A[i]>A[j] then
begin
c:=A[i];  A[i]:=A[j];  A[j]:=c
end;
writeln('РЕЗУЛЬТАТ:');
for i:=1 to 10 do
writeln('A[',i:2,']=',A[i]:3);

End.

Комментариев нет:

Отправить комментарий